Pasture Clearing in Houston, TX
Pasture clearing services involve removing overgrown grass, weeds, brush, and small trees to prepare land for agricultural use, construction, or property enhancement. This process typically covers projects such as creating new pasture land, clearing areas for fencing or building sites, or restoring overgrown fields. Property owners usually want to understand the extent of clearing needed, the types of vegetation involved, and any potential impact on the soil or surrounding landscape before requesting services.
Homeowners and landowners often inquire about the best methods for clearing their property, whether it involves manual removal or machinery, and how to manage debris afterward. Clarifying the scope of work, including the size of the area and the types of vegetation to be removed, helps ensure the project meets expectations. Understanding these details can also assist in planning for future land use, whether for farming, recreation, or development purposes.

Common Pasture Clearing Jobs
Pasture Clearing Services - clearing overgrown fields to improve land usability and aesthetics.
Brush Removal - removing dense brush and undergrowth to reduce fire hazards and enhance property appearance.
Tree and Shrub Clearing - cutting back or removing unwanted trees and shrubs to create open space.
Stump Grinding - grinding down tree stumps to prepare land for future use or landscaping.
Fence Line Clearing - clearing vegetation along fence lines to maintain property boundaries and access.
Land Grading and Debris Removal - leveling land and removing debris for safe and functional outdoor spaces.
Pasture Clearing Questions
What is pasture clearing? Pasture clearing involves removing unwanted trees, brush, and debris to prepare land for grazing, farming, or development.
When should pasture clearing be considered? It is typically done when overgrowth hinders land use, livestock access, or crop planting.
What types of projects require pasture clearing? Projects include land preparation for agriculture, property development, or reclaiming overgrown fields.
What should property owners know before starting pasture clearing? Proper planning ensures the removal process aligns with land use goals and local regulations.
